るようにした、多色箔押し方法に関する。D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ION (Industrial Application Field) The present invention relates to a multicolor foil stamping method that allows images and the like to be expressed in color by foil stamping.
(従米技術および発明力ご解決しようとする課題)箔押
しのもつ金属光沢は、他の印刷では望めない高級な印象
を与えるため、ラベル、パッケージを始めとして各種製
品のデザインに採用されている。しかしながら、従米の
箔押しは、いわば単一色による印刷であるため、マーク
とか文字ならともかく、対象が画像となると抽象的な表
現となってしまうため、リアリティーに欠けるとともに
装飾性においても不充分なところがあった。(Problems to be solved by advanced technology and inventiveness) The metallic luster of foil stamping gives a high-class impression that cannot be achieved with other printing methods, so it is used in the design of various products, including labels and packages. However, Jubei's foil stamping is a single-color printing process, so if the target is an image, it becomes an abstract expression, which lacks reality and is insufficient in terms of decoration. Ta.
この発明は、従米技術のこのような欠陥に鑑みてなされ
たものであり、その目的とするところは、原稿のもつ本
来の色をできるだけカラー再現でき、リアリティーのみ
ならず装飾性にも冨んだ箔押しを得ることができる、多
色箔押し方法を提供するにある。This invention was made in view of these deficiencies in conventional American technology, and its purpose was to reproduce the original colors of originals as much as possible, and to provide not only realism but also rich decorativeness. To provide a multicolor foil stamping method that can obtain foil stamping.

成する。(Means for Solving the Problems) In order to achieve the above object, a multicolor foil stamping method according to the present invention has the following configuration. That is, a color document representing an image or the like is subjected to color separation, halftone shooting, etc. to create a separated halftone negative film. Then, a plurality of letterpress plates for foil stamping are created based on all or a part of the negative film obtained by adding a negative film for solid printing to this decomposed mesh negative film.
これら凸版を印刷量の多い順に用いて、異なる色の箔を
重ね合わせるように分色押印し、前記原稿をカラー再現
する。These relief plates are used in descending order of printing amount, and the original is reproduced in color by stamping the different colors so that foils of different colors are overlapped.

、コスト的には安価である。The reason for excluding the yellow and magenta versions is as follows. That is, in each of the halftone 7 films 2 to 5 in which the spiny lobster of the manuscript 1 was subjected to halftone dot resolution, the halftone dot density was higher in the order of black, cyan, magenta, and yellow, that is, the amount of printing was large. Therefore, if the yellow printing plate, which has the largest amount of printing, is used, most of the base color foil stamped with the solid letterpress plate 11 will be hidden, and the meaning of the solid printing will be halved. By the way, in the actual example carried out, gold foil was selected as the base color foil. Additionally, since the magenta version had the second largest amount of printing, stamping with red foil on this version had the disadvantage that the redness was too strong. Therefore, a red foil was stamped on the base color using cyan letterpress 9. On top of these, a black foil was stamped in an overlapping manner using ink letterpress 10, which has the smallest amount of printing, to reproduce the foil-stamped restoration 12 that reproduces the Ise lobster, which is the image of manuscript 1, with good color balance.
I got it. In this way, even if only some of the five editions are used, a highly complete restored product can be obtained, and the cost is low.
但し、5版全部もしくは一部の版のみを使用するにして
も、その版数に関係なく、印刷量の多い版から順に用い
るようにして箔を押印する必要がある。即ち、箔の重ね
合わせにおいては、一般のカラー印刷とは異なり色の混
合はなく、下の色に上の色が覆いかぶさるのみである.
従って、後から印刷量の多い版を使用すると、先に押印
した箔の色が消えてしまい、カラーバランスが崩れると
いう弊害が生じる。However, even if all five editions or only some of the editions are used, it is necessary to stamp the foil by using the editions with the largest amount of printing, regardless of the number of editions. In other words, in the overlapping of foils, unlike in general color printing, there is no mixing of colors, but only the upper color covers the lower color.
Therefore, if a plate with a large amount of printing is used later, the color of the foil stamped earlier will disappear, resulting in a problem that the color balance will be disrupted.
